All power storage units, such as BatBox,CES Unit, MFE, and MFSU can emit redstone signal by listed conditions:
- Nothing - feature is off
- Emit if full - device starts emit signal at (Full_Capacity - One_Quantum) charge
- Emit if partially filled - device starts emit signal at (One_quantum) charge, ends at (Full_Capacity - One_Quantum)
- Emit if partially filled or empty - device starts emit signal at zero charge, ends at (Full_Capacity - One_Quantum)
- Emit if empty - device starts emit signal at zero charge, ends at (One_Quantum)
- Do not output energy - no redstone signal emitted, device output off
- Do not output energy unless full - no redstone signal emitted, device output off until its charge less than (Full_Capacity - One_Quantum)
Redstone signal applies always to block directly under the power storage. This feature is very useful for control of nuclear reactors.
